Bug description:
[Impact]
On my setup, pokerth crashes 100% of the time when trying to create and join a LAN game between 2 computers running Ubuntu 12.04 LTS.
[Test Case]
1) connect your 2 computers running ubuntu on a network (in my case, on my internet routeur)
2) start pokerth on both computer
3) on one of the computer, click option 3 and create a LAN network game
4) on the other, choose option 4 and enter the ip address of the first computer (I used ifconfig)
5) progress bar gets stuck at 80% and pokerth crashes, nothing happens for the host computer
Expected behaviour: depends on the problem, but
1) it should not crash
2) it should display the reason of the failed attempt
[Regression Potential]
Low, the fix was commited to upstream Git (https://github.com/pokerth/pokerth/commit/7bc8c1b9f288c1591570f466dce318828acbf486) two month ago and is in the current upstream stable release, working fine there and in Debian.
